Kernel Freeze RH8.0

I have received and updated the Kernel for my system several times.

I am running  version 2.4.18-27.8.0 without any problems at all.

I have upgraded to versions 2.4.20-18.8 , 2.4.20-19.8.0 and 2.4.20-20.8
via the RHN up2date facility and for some reason all versions load
after  the one which I am currently running freeze up the computer
completely, NO MOUSE or KEYBOARD action at all.  This freeze up takes
from 30 minutes to a few hours to occur, a Power down and reboot is the
only way to get it back up.  
With version 2.4.18-27.8.0 I
can leave the computer running all day without a freeze.

Anyone else have this problem and is there a known fix for it.
